About Mr Nadeem Ali

Mr. Nadeem Ali is an internationally renowned Consultant Ophthalmologist who specialises exclusively in adult squint (strabismus) surgery. Practising at the London Squint Clinic, he is one of the very few eye surgeons worldwide whose entire clinical focus is devoted to the surgical correction of squint and the treatment of diplopia (double vision).  Mr. Ali pursued his medical education at Gonville and Caius College, the premier medical college of the University of Cambridge. He graduated with a rare triple First Class degree, having topped his year twice and receiving a total of 16 academic awards. During his time at Cambridge, he conducted research into ocular motor control with world-leading professors. Following his medical qualification, he undertook seven years of specialist ophthalmology training in the Northern Region, with a primary base at the Royal Victoria Infirmary. He then completed a prestigious fellowship in squint surgery under the mentorship of international expert Mike Clarke. To further broaden his expertise, Mr. Ali also trained in neuro-ophthalmology at the National Hospital for Neurology and Neurosurgery in London, where he gained valuable experience in managing complex disorders of eye movement. In 2010, Mr. Ali was appointed Consultant Squint Surgeon at Moorfields Eye Hospital in London, one of the world's most prestigious eye hospitals. There, he worked alongside leading squint specialist John Lee, refining his skills in the management of advanced strabismus and double vision cases. He served as Lead for Adult Squint Surgery at Moorfields South and played a key role in monitoring surgical safety standards within the Trust. His published analysis of 4,000 squint surgeries has become a benchmark for surgical safety in the field. In 2023, he left Moorfields to focus entirely on his private practice at the London Squint Clinic. Beyond his work in London, Mr. Ali is a visiting consultant squint surgeon to the Gibraltar Health Authority and the government eye hospital in Reykjavik, Iceland. He has mentored fellows in squint surgery from both the UK and overseas and is widely respected for his dedication to patient care. In recognition of his service, he has been honoured with an NHS Hero Award.
